No man is born believing that he has dominion over women. Instead, this view is handed down from generation to generation and amplified through social custom, culture, and popular media.
Cyril Ramaphosa
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

Beliefs about gender dominance are learned and perpetuated by society rather than being innate.

This quote by Cyril Ramaphosa emphasizes that the idea of male dominance over women is not something inherent at birth but rather a learned behavior that is transmitted through various societal channels such as customs, culture, and media. It suggests that patriarchal beliefs are not natural but constructed, highlighting the need to challenge and change these longstanding narratives to promote equality.
